>>> Running ebuild phase killold as root:root... >>> Starting builtin_killold >>> Done builtin_killold >>> Completed ebuild phase killold >>> Running ebuild phases init saveenv as paludisbuild:paludisbuild... >>> Starting builtin_init >>> Done builtin_init >>> Starting builtin_saveenv >>> Done builtin_saveenv >>> Completed ebuild phases init saveenv --- No need to do anything for setup phase >>> Running ebuild phases loadenv unpack saveenv as paludisbuild:paludisbuild... >>> Starting builtin_loadenv >>> Done builtin_loadenv >>> Starting src_unpack >>> Unpacking fltk-1.1.9-source.tar.bz2 to /var/tmp/paludis/x11-libs-fltk-1.1.9/work tar jxf /usr/portage/distfiles/fltk-1.1.9-source.tar.bz2 --no-same-owner >>> Done src_unpack >>> Starting builtin_saveenv >>> Done builtin_saveenv >>> Completed ebuild phases loadenv unpack saveenv >>> Running ebuild phases loadenv prepare saveenv as paludisbuild:paludisbuild... >>> Starting builtin_loadenv >>> Done builtin_loadenv >>> Starting src_prepare * Applying fltk-1.1.9-desktop.patch ...  [ ok ] * Applying fltk-1.1.9-as-needed.patch ...  [ ok ] * Applying fltk-1.1.9-conf-tests.patch ...  [ ok ] * Running autoconf ...  [ ok ] >>> Done src_prepare >>> Starting builtin_saveenv >>> Done builtin_saveenv >>> Completed ebuild phases loadenv prepare saveenv >>> Running ebuild phases loadenv configure saveenv as paludisbuild:paludisbuild... >>> Starting builtin_loadenv >>> Done builtin_loadenv >>> Starting src_configure ./configure --prefix=/usr --host=x86_64-pc-linux-gnu --mandir=/usr/share/man --infodir=/usr/share/info --datadir=/usr/share --sysconfdir=/etc --localstatedir=/var/lib --libdir=/usr/lib64 --includedir=/usr/include/fltk-1.1 --libdir=/usr/lib64/fltk-1.1 --docdir=/usr/share/doc/fltk-1.1.9/html --enable-largefile --enable-shared --enable-xdbe --enable-gl --disable-threads --disable-xft --enable-xinerama --build=x86_64-pc-linux-gnu checking for x86_64-pc-linux-gnu-gcc... x86_64-pc-linux-gnu-gcc checking for C compiler default output file name... a.out checking whether the C compiler works... yes checking whether we are cross compiling... no checking for suffix of executables... checking for suffix of object files... o checking whether we are using the GNU C compiler... yes checking whether x86_64-pc-linux-gnu-gcc accepts -g... yes checking for x86_64-pc-linux-gnu-gcc option to accept ISO C89... none needed checking for x86_64-pc-linux-gnu-g++... x86_64-pc-linux-gnu-g++ checking whether we are using the GNU C++ compiler... yes checking whether x86_64-pc-linux-gnu-g++ accepts -g... yes checking for a BSD-compatible install... /usr/bin/install -c checking for nroff... /usr/bin/nroff checking for htmldoc... no checking for x86_64-pc-linux-gnu-ranlib... x86_64-pc-linux-gnu-ranlib checking for ar... /usr/bin/ar checking how to run the C preprocessor... x86_64-pc-linux-gnu-gcc -E checking for grep that handles long lines and -e... /bin/grep checking for egrep... /bin/grep -E checking for ANSI C header files... yes checking for sys/types.h... yes checking for sys/stat.h... yes checking for stdlib.h... yes checking for string.h... yes checking for memory.h... yes checking for strings.h... yes checking for inttypes.h... yes checking for stdint.h... yes checking for unistd.h... yes checking whether byte ordering is bigendian... no checking size of short... 2 checking size of int... 4 checking size of long... 8 checking whether the compiler recognizes bool as a built-in type... yes checking for dirent.h that defines DIR... yes checking for library containing opendir... none required checking sys/select.h usability... yes checking sys/select.h presence... yes checking for sys/select.h... yes checking sys/stdtypes.h usability... no checking sys/stdtypes.h presence... no checking for sys/stdtypes.h... no checking for scandir... yes checking for vsnprintf... yes checking for snprintf... yes checking for strings.h... (cached) yes checking for strcasecmp... yes checking for strlcat... no checking for strlcpy... no checking locale.h usability... yes checking locale.h presence... yes checking for locale.h... yes checking for localeconv... yes checking for library containing pow... -lm checking for special C compiler options needed for large files... no checking for _FILE_OFFSET_BITS value needed for large files... no checking for long long int... yes checking for strtoll... yes checking for library containing dlsym... -ldl checking dlfcn.h usability... yes checking dlfcn.h presence... yes checking for dlfcn.h... yes checking alsa/asoundlib.h usability... yes checking alsa/asoundlib.h presence... yes checking for alsa/asoundlib.h... yes checking for jpeg_CreateCompress in -ljpeg... yes checking for gzgets in -lz... yes checking for png_set_tRNS_to_alpha in -lpng... yes checking png.h usability... yes checking png.h presence... yes checking for png.h... yes checking for X... libraries , headers checking for gethostbyname... yes checking for connect... yes checking for remove... yes checking for shmat... yes checking for IceConnectionNumber in -lICE... yes configure: WARNING: Ignoring libraries " -lSM -lICE" requested by configure. checking for library containing dlopen... none required checking GL/gl.h usability... yes checking GL/gl.h presence... yes checking for GL/gl.h... yes checking for glXMakeCurrent in -lGL... yes checking for glXGetProcAddressARB in -lGL... yes checking GL/glu.h usability... yes checking GL/glu.h presence... yes checking for GL/glu.h... yes checking for XineramaIsActive in -lXinerama... yes checking for X11/extensions/Xdbe.h... yes checking for xprop... /usr/bin/xprop checking for X overlay visuals... no checking if GCC supports -fno-exceptions... yes checking if GCC supports -fno-strict-aliasing... yes Configuration Summary ------------------------------------------------------------------------- Directories: prefix=/usr bindir=${exec_prefix}/bin datadir=/usr/share datarootdir=${prefix}/share exec_prefix=${prefix} includedir=/usr/include/fltk-1.1 libdir=/usr/lib64/fltk-1.1 mandir=/usr/share/man Graphics: X11+Xdbe+Xinerama Image Libraries: JPEG=System PNG=System ZLIB=System Large Files: YES OpenGL: YES Threads: NO configure: creating ./config.status config.status: creating makeinclude config.status: creating fltk.list config.status: creating fltk-config config.status: creating fltk.spec config.status: creating FL/Makefile config.status: creating config.h >>> Done src_configure >>> Starting builtin_saveenv >>> Done builtin_saveenv >>> Completed ebuild phases loadenv configure saveenv >>> Running ebuild phases loadenv compile saveenv as paludisbuild:paludisbuild... >>> Starting builtin_loadenv >>> Done builtin_loadenv >>> Starting src_compile make -j9 === making src === Compiling Fl.cxx... Compiling Fl_Adjuster.cxx... Compiling Fl_Bitmap.cxx... Compiling Fl_Browser.cxx... Compiling Fl_Browser_.cxx... Compiling Fl_Browser_load.cxx... Compiling Fl_Box.cxx... Compiling Fl_Button.cxx... Compiling Fl_Chart.cxx... Compiling Fl_Check_Browser.cxx... Compiling Fl_Check_Button.cxx... Compiling Fl_Choice.cxx... Compiling Fl_Clock.cxx... Compiling Fl_Color_Chooser.cxx... Compiling Fl_Counter.cxx... Fl.cxx: In static member function 'static int Fl::handle(int, Fl_Window*)': Fl.cxx:715: warning: suggest parentheses around && within || Compiling Fl_Dial.cxx... Compiling Fl_Double_Window.cxx... Fl_Browser.cxx: In member function 'virtual int Fl_Browser::item_height(void*) const': Fl_Browser.cxx:236: warning: ignoring return value of 'long int strtol(const char*, char**, int)', declared with attribute warn_unused_result Fl_Browser.cxx: In member function 'virtual int Fl_Browser::item_width(void*) const': Fl_Browser.cxx:286: warning: ignoring return value of 'long int strtol(const char*, char**, int)', declared with attribute warn_unused_result Fl_Browser.cxx: In member function 'virtual void Fl_Browser::item_draw(void*, int, int, int, int) const': Fl_Browser.cxx:346: warning: ignoring return value of 'long int strtol(const char*, char**, int)', declared with attribute warn_unused_result Compiling Fl_File_Browser.cxx... Compiling Fl_File_Chooser.cxx... Compiling Fl_File_Chooser2.cxx... Compiling Fl_File_Icon.cxx... Compiling Fl_File_Input.cxx... Compiling Fl_Group.cxx... Compiling Fl_Help_View.cxx... Fl_Group.cxx: In member function 'virtual void Fl_Group::resize(int, int, int, int)': Fl_Group.cxx:466: warning: suggest parentheses around && within || Compiling Fl_Image.cxx... Compiling Fl_Input.cxx... Compiling Fl_Input_.cxx... Fl_File_Chooser2.cxx: In member function 'void Fl_File_Chooser::fileNameCB()': Fl_File_Chooser2.cxx:572: warning: format not a string literal and no format arguments Fl_File_Chooser2.cxx: In member function 'void Fl_File_Chooser::newdir()': Fl_File_Chooser2.cxx:760: warning: format not a string literal and no format arguments Fl_File_Chooser2.cxx: In member function 'void Fl_File_Chooser::showChoiceCB()': Fl_File_Chooser2.cxx:931: warning: format not a string literal and no format arguments Fl_Input.cxx: In member function 'int Fl_Input::handle_key()': Fl_Input.cxx:124: warning: suggest parentheses around && within || Fl_Input.cxx:127: warning: suggest parentheses around && within || Fl_Input.cxx:128: warning: suggest parentheses around && within || Compiling Fl_Menu.cxx... Compiling Fl_Light_Button.cxx... Fl_Input_.cxx: In member function 'int Fl_Input_::undo()': Fl_Input_.cxx:641: warning: suggest parentheses around && within || Fl_Input.cxx: In member function 'virtual int Fl_Input::handle(int)': Fl_Input.cxx:369: warning: suggest parentheses around && within || Fl_Help_View.cxx: In member function 'Fl_Shared_Image* Fl_Help_View::get_image(const char*, int, int)': Fl_Help_View.cxx:2600: warning: ignoring return value of 'char* getcwd(char*, size_t)', declared with attribute warn_unused_result Fl_Help_View.cxx: In member function 'void Fl_Help_View::follow_link(Fl_Help_Link*)': Fl_Help_View.cxx:2691: warning: ignoring return value of 'char* getcwd(char*, size_t)', declared with attribute warn_unused_result Fl_Menu.cxx: In member function 'virtual int menuwindow::handle(int)': Fl_Menu.cxx:647: warning: suggest parentheses around && within || Fl_Menu.cxx:730: warning: suggest parentheses around && within || Fl_Help_View.cxx: In member function 'int Fl_Help_View::load(const char*)': Fl_Help_View.cxx:3141: warning: ignoring return value of 'size_t fread(void*, size_t, size_t, FILE*)', declared with attribute warn_unused_result Compiling Fl_Menu_.cxx... Compiling Fl_Menu_Bar.cxx... Compiling Fl_Menu_Button.cxx... Compiling Fl_Sys_Menu_Bar.cxx... Compiling Fl_Menu_Window.cxx... Compiling Fl_Menu_add.cxx... Compiling Fl_Menu_global.cxx... Compiling Fl_Multi_Label.cxx... Compiling Fl_Overlay_Window.cxx... Compiling Fl_Pack.cxx... Compiling Fl_Positioner.cxx... Compiling Fl_Pixmap.cxx... Compiling Fl_Preferences.cxx... Compiling Fl_Progress.cxx... Fl_Preferences.cxx: In function 'char* decodeText(const char*)': Fl_Preferences.cxx:309: warning: suggest explicit braces to avoid ambiguous 'else' Fl_Preferences.cxx: In member function 'int Fl_Preferences::RootNode::read()': Fl_Preferences.cxx:769: warning: ignoring return value of 'char* fgets(char*, int, FILE*)', declared with attribute warn_unused_result Fl_Preferences.cxx:770: warning: ignoring return value of 'char* fgets(char*, int, FILE*)', declared with attribute warn_unused_result Fl_Preferences.cxx:771: warning: ignoring return value of 'char* fgets(char*, int, FILE*)', declared with attribute warn_unused_result Fl_Preferences.cxx: In member function 'int Fl_Preferences::Node::write(FILE*)': Fl_Preferences.cxx:905: warning: ignoring return value of 'size_t fwrite(const void*, size_t, size_t, FILE*)', declared with attribute warn_unused_result Fl_Preferences.cxx:913: warning: ignoring return value of 'size_t fwrite(const void*, size_t, size_t, FILE*)', declared with attribute warn_unused_result Compiling Fl_Repeat_Button.cxx... Compiling Fl_Return_Button.cxx... Compiling Fl_Roller.cxx... Compiling Fl_Round_Button.cxx... Compiling Fl_Scroll.cxx... Compiling Fl_Scrollbar.cxx... Compiling Fl_Shared_Image.cxx... Compiling Fl_Single_Window.cxx... Compiling Fl_Slider.cxx... Fl_Shared_Image.cxx: In member function 'void Fl_Shared_Image::reload()': Fl_Shared_Image.cxx:227: warning: ignoring return value of 'size_t fread(void*, size_t, size_t, FILE*)', declared with attribute warn_unused_result Compiling Fl_Tabs.cxx... Compiling Fl_Text_Buffer.cxx... Fl_Tabs.cxx: In member function 'int Fl_Tabs::push(Fl_Widget*)': Fl_Tabs.cxx:245: warning: suggest parentheses around && within || Compiling Fl_Text_Display.cxx... Fl_Text_Buffer.cxx: In member function 'int Fl_Text_Buffer::undo(int*)': Fl_Text_Buffer.cxx:351: warning: suggest parentheses around && within || Compiling Fl_Text_Editor.cxx... Fl_Text_Buffer.cxx: In function 'char chooseNullSubsChar(char*)': Fl_Text_Buffer.cxx:1338: warning: array subscript has type 'char' Compiling Fl_Tile.cxx... Compiling Fl_Tiled_Image.cxx... Fl_Tile.cxx: In member function 'void Fl_Tile::position(int, int, int, int)': Fl_Tile.cxx:51: warning: suggest parentheses around && within || Fl_Tile.cxx:51: warning: suggest parentheses around && within || Fl_Tile.cxx:53: warning: suggest parentheses around && within || Fl_Tile.cxx:53: warning: suggest parentheses around && within || Fl_Tile.cxx:59: warning: suggest parentheses around && within || Fl_Tile.cxx:59: warning: suggest parentheses around && within || Fl_Tile.cxx:61: warning: suggest parentheses around && within || Fl_Tile.cxx:61: warning: suggest parentheses around && within || Compiling Fl_Tooltip.cxx... Compiling Fl_Valuator.cxx... Compiling Fl_Value_Input.cxx... Compiling Fl_Value_Output.cxx... Compiling Fl_Value_Slider.cxx... Compiling Fl_Widget.cxx... Compiling Fl_Window.cxx... Compiling Fl_Window_fullscreen.cxx... Compiling Fl_Window_iconize.cxx... Compiling Fl_Window_hotspot.cxx... Compiling Fl_Wizard.cxx... Compiling Fl_XBM_Image.cxx... Compiling Fl_XPM_Image.cxx... Compiling Fl_abort.cxx... Compiling Fl_add_idle.cxx... Compiling Fl_arg.cxx... Compiling Fl_compose.cxx... Fl_XPM_Image.cxx: In constructor 'Fl_XPM_Image::Fl_XPM_Image(const char*)': Fl_XPM_Image.cxx:75: warning: ignoring return value of 'char* fgets(char*, int, FILE*)', declared with attribute warn_unused_result Fl_XPM_Image.cxx: In constructor 'Fl_XPM_Image::Fl_XPM_Image(const char*)': Fl_XPM_Image.cxx:75: warning: ignoring return value of 'char* fgets(char*, int, FILE*)', declared with attribute warn_unused_result Fl_XPM_Image.cxx: In constructor 'Fl_XPM_Image::Fl_XPM_Image(const char*)': Fl_XPM_Image.cxx:75: warning: ignoring return value of 'char* fgets(char*, int, FILE*)', declared with attribute warn_unused_result Fl_compose.cxx: In static member function 'static int Fl::compose(int&)': Fl_compose.cxx:164: warning: suggest parentheses around && within || Compiling Fl_display.cxx... Compiling Fl_get_key.cxx... Compiling Fl_get_system_colors.cxx... Compiling Fl_grab.cxx... Compiling Fl_own_colormap.cxx... Compiling Fl_lock.cxx... Compiling Fl_visual.cxx... Compiling Fl_x.cxx... Compiling filename_absolute.cxx... Compiling filename_expand.cxx... Compiling filename_ext.cxx... Compiling filename_isdir.cxx... Fl_x.cxx: In function 'int can_boxcheat(uchar)': Fl_x.cxx:1372: warning: suggest parentheses around && within || Compiling filename_list.cxx... Compiling filename_match.cxx... Compiling filename_setext.cxx... Compiling fl_arc.cxx... filename_list.cxx: In function 'int fl_filename_list(const char*, dirent***, int (*)(dirent**, dirent**))': filename_list.cxx:70: error: invalid conversion from 'int (*)(const void*, const void*)' to 'int (*)(const dirent**, const dirent**)' filename_list.cxx:70: error: initializing argument 4 of 'int scandir(const char*, dirent***, int (*)(const dirent*), int (*)(const dirent**, const dirent**))' make[1]: *** [filename_list.o] Error 1 make[1]: *** Waiting for unfinished jobs.... make: *** [all] Error 1 /usr/libexec/paludis/utils/emake: emake returned error 2 !!! ERROR in x11-libs/fltk-1.1.9: !!! In src_compile at line 4280 !!! emake failed !!! Call stack: !!! * src_compile (/var/tmp/paludis/x11-libs-fltk-1.1.9/temp/loadsaveenv:4280) !!! * ebuild_f_compile (/usr/libexec/paludis/2/src_compile.bash:54) !!! * ebuild_main (/usr/libexec/paludis/ebuild.bash:482) !!! * main (/usr/libexec/paludis/ebuild.bash:498) diefunc: making ebuild PID 16362 exit with error die trap: exiting with error. Install error: * In program paludis -i1 fltk:1.1: * When performing install action from command line: * When executing install task: * When installing 'x11-libs/fltk-1.1.9:1.1::gentoo' replacing { 'x11-libs/fltk-1.1.9:1.1::installed' }: * When running an ebuild command on 'x11-libs/fltk-1.1.9:1.1::gentoo': * Install error: Install failed for 'x11-libs/fltk-1.1.9:1.1::gentoo'